英文摘要
Age-adjusted (world) oral cancer (OC) incidence and mortality rates for Puerto Rico (PR) are among the
highest in the Western Hemisphere. Early diagnosis of oral cancer will decrease the morbidity and mortality
resultant from this disease and its treatment. The objective of Healthy People 2010 is to increase the
percentage of oral and pharyngeal cancers (stage I, localized) detected at the earliest stage to 50%.
Unfortunately, the Commonwealth of Puerto Rico appears to have a deficit in early cancer detection that is
strikingly worse than the mainland U.S. We have reported an ¿inverse triangle¿ of invasive carcinomas to in situ
carcinomas and premalignant oral cancer lesions, i.e., significantly more pathology sign-out diagnoses for oral
cancer than the other lesion types. Thus, routinely including oral cancer examinations in clinical practice will
detect both more pre-malignant and earlier oral cancers with the result of decreasing the morbidity and
mortality in Puerto Rico. The long-term goal of this project is to strengthen secondary prevention of oral cancer
by increasing the practice of head and neck examinations in dental practices in terms of the a) proportion of
persons screened, b) the frequency of screenings (initial, recall exams), and c) the quality of the screenings.
The Specific Aims are: 1) identify methods to change OC screening practice behaviors by dentists in Puerto
Rico, 2) identify emerging technologies that will increase practitioner screening in Puerto Rico, 3) identify
emerging social trends and activities that will increase practitioner screening in Puerto Rico , and 4) based on
the findings from Specific Aims #1-3, define a pragmatic implementation strategy for increasing practitioner
screening for oral cancer in Puerto Rico. To accomplish the Specific Aims, qualitative investigative methods
(i.e., expert focus groups and key informant interviews) will be conducted to obtain the necessary data from
Specific Aims #1-3 to allow accomplishing Specific Aim #4. Thus, culturally/professionally acceptable methods,
technologies and activities can be developed that are recognized by the targeted group (dentists) as being
acceptable as well as productive in increasing the frequency of oral cancer screenings. These objectives will
be accomplished by an experienced multi-disciplinary research team. Significance: By focusing public health
and professional activities on highly acceptable oral cancer screening dissemination and implementation
operations that are based on the findings of this project, oral cancer morbidity and mortality will be decreased
in Puerto Rico.
